千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> python字典元素个数

python字典元素个数

来源:千锋教育
发布人:xqq
时间: 2024-03-04 17:03:23 1709543003

**Python字典元素个数的重要性及相关问答**

_x000D_

Python字典是一种无序的可变容器模型,它用键值对(key-value)的形式存储数据。字典中的键是唯一的,而值则可以重复。字典的元素个数指的是字典中键值对的数量。在Python编程中,字典元素个数的统计和使用是非常重要的。本文将围绕Python字典元素个数展开,探讨其重要性以及相关问答。

_x000D_

**一、Python字典元素个数的重要性**

_x000D_

Python字典元素个数的重要性体现在以下几个方面:

_x000D_

1. **快速判断字典是否为空**:通过判断字典元素个数是否为零,可以快速判断字典是否为空,避免不必要的操作和错误。

_x000D_

2. **快速遍历字典**:通过遍历字典的键值对,可以快速访问字典中的所有元素。字典元素个数的统计可以作为遍历的次数,帮助我们更高效地处理字典中的数据。

_x000D_

3. **判断键是否存在**:通过判断字典元素个数是否大于零,可以快速判断指定的键是否存在于字典中,避免了无效的键查找操作。

_x000D_

4. **优化内存使用**:了解字典元素个数可以帮助我们合理安排内存空间,避免过度分配或浪费内存资源。

_x000D_

**二、相关问答**

_x000D_

**1. 如何统计字典的元素个数?**

_x000D_

可以使用内置函数len()来统计字典的元素个数。例如,对于字典my_dict,可以使用len(my_dict)来获取其元素个数。

_x000D_

**2. 如何判断字典是否为空?**

_x000D_

通过判断字典元素个数是否为零,可以判断字典是否为空。例如,可以使用len(my_dict) == 0来判断字典my_dict是否为空。

_x000D_

**3. 如何遍历字典的键值对?**

_x000D_

可以使用for循环遍历字典的键值对。例如,可以使用以下代码来遍历字典my_dict的键值对:

_x000D_

`python

_x000D_

for key, value in my_dict.items():

_x000D_

print(key, value)

_x000D_ _x000D_

**4. 如何判断指定的键是否存在于字典中?**

_x000D_

可以通过判断指定的键是否在字典的键集合中,来判断该键是否存在于字典中。例如,可以使用key in my_dict来判断键key是否存在于字典my_dict中。

_x000D_

**5. 如何删除字典中的所有元素?**

_x000D_

可以使用字典的clear()方法来删除字典中的所有元素。例如,可以使用my_dict.clear()来清空字典my_dict中的所有元素。

_x000D_

**三、结语**

_x000D_

本文围绕Python字典元素个数展开,介绍了字典元素个数的重要性,并提供了相关的问答。了解字典元素个数的统计和使用方法,有助于我们更好地处理和操作字典数据。通过合理利用字典元素个数,我们可以提高代码的效率和可读性,更加灵活地应对各种编程需求。

_x000D_
tags: python教程
声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T